Nueva Vizcaya is a landlocked province located in the northeastern part of the Philippines, situated within the Cagayan Valley region on the island of Luzon. Positioned in the central part of the valley, it serves as a strategic gateway between the Cagayan Valley and Central Luzon regions. With an approximate population of around 497,000 people spread across its 2,655 square kilometer territory, Nueva Vizcaya features diverse topography ranging from fertile valleys to mountainous terrain, including portions of the Caraballo and Sierra Madre mountain ranges. The province is administratively divided into 15 municipalities, with Bayombong serving as the provincial capital. Known for its agricultural productivity, Nueva Vizcaya produces significant quantities of rice, corn, and various fruits, earning it the nickname 'Citrus Capital of the Philippines.' The province also contains important watershed areas that contribute to the region's water resources.
